Abstract
The invention provides a textile mildewproof agent. The textile mildewproof agent consists of the following components by mass percent: 25-28% of sodium acetate, 13-16% of stearic acid, 20-24% of cinnamaldehyde, 10-15% of glycerin and 25-32% of lignin. The invention further provides a preparation method of the textile mildewproof agent. The method comprises the following steps of: uniformly mixing the sodium acetate, the stearic acid, the cinnamaldehyde and the glycerin at 65 DEG C, adding the ground lignin, heating to 75 DEG C, uniformly stirring and standing to the room temperature. The sodium acetate is served as a main sterilization ingredient, does not corrode and damage textiles, the lignin has high dispersity, high adhesiveness and a firm framework structure, maintains dryness and good air permeability and uniformly acts for a long time. Consequently, the textile mildewproof agent has a good mildewproof effect as well as the characteristics of low cost, safety and environmental friendliness.
Description
Technical field
The present invention relates to a kind of anti-mildew agent for textiles.
Background technology
Along with the development of society, the raising of economic level, large-scale light industry enterprise particularly textile enterprise's quantity rolls up.Textiles is various in style, and majority easily goes mouldy, as cotton, fiber crops, hair, vinylon, nylon, acrylic fibers spray silk etc.Thereby the storage of textile product and raw material also becomes the difficult problem of these enterprises.For the control that textile product goes mouldy, many factories have to strengthen the administration of health of expecting the whole process of product processing from former.But under many circumstances, control the initial contaminant capacity of microorganism or arrange that all environmental conditions that is unfavorable for growth of microorganism normally can not accomplish, also need to use mould inhibitor to control microorganism to the pollution and harm of production environment, material, product.
Summary of the invention
The object of the present invention is to provide the good anti-mildew agent for textiles of a kind of anti-mold effect, simultaneously, the present invention also provides the preparation method of this anti-mildew agent for textiles.
The invention provides a kind of anti-mildew agent for textiles, described anti-mildew agent for textiles is comprised of each component of following mass percent: sodium acetate 25-28%, stearic acid 13-16%, cinnamic acid 20-24%, glycerine 10-15%, lignin 25-32%.
Preferably, described anti-mildew agent for textiles is comprised of each component of following mass percent: sodium acetate 26%, stearic acid 14%, cinnamic acid 20%, glycerine 12%, lignin 28%.
The present invention also provides the preparation method of this anti-mildew agent for textiles, is 65 ℃ of sodium acetates, stearic acid, cinnamic acid, glycerine are mixed, and adds the lignin after grinding, is warming up to 75 ℃ and stirs, and is placed to room temperature and gets final product.
It is main sterilization composition that the present invention adopts sodium acetate, and without the corrosion not damaged, and lignin has high degree of dispersion, high tack and frame structure firmly, keeps dry and fine air permeability, lastingly effect equably to textiles.Therefore, product anti-mold effect of the present invention is good, and has that cost is low, the characteristics of safety and environmental protection.
The specific embodiment
Embodiment 1
Anti-mildew agent for textiles of the present invention is comprised of following component:
Sodium acetate 26g, stearic acid 14g, cinnamic acid 20g, glycerine 12g, lignin 28g.
The preparation method of anti-mildew agent for textiles of the present invention is: 65 ℃ of sodium acetate, stearic acid, cinnamic acid, the glycerine of proportional quantity are mixed, add the lignin after grinding, be warming up to 75 ℃ and stir, be placed to room temperature and get final product.
Embodiment 2
Anti-mildew agent for textiles of the present invention is comprised of following component:
Sodium acetate 25g, stearic acid 13g, cinnamic acid 20g, glycerine 10g, lignin 32g.
Identical in preparation method in the present embodiment and embodiment 1.
Embodiment 3
Anti-mildew agent for textiles of the present invention is comprised of following component:
Sodium acetate 27g, stearic acid 14g, cinnamic acid 24g, glycerine 10g, lignin 25g.
Identical in preparation method in the present embodiment and embodiment 1.
Embodiment 4
Anti-mildew agent for textiles of the present invention is comprised of following component:
Sodium acetate 280g, stearic acid 160g, cinnamic acid 200g, glycerine 110g, lignin 250g.
Identical in preparation method in the present embodiment and embodiment 1.
